A 5 kg bowling ball, a 0.25 kg baseball, and a 0.05 kg golf ball are dropped from a 100-meter high building. A camera catches th

e motion of the balls as they pass specific markers (in meters, m) on the building. The times (in seconds, s) that each object passes the markers are listed in the table below. Which of the following conclusions is true?
A.Objects of different shapes fall at the same rate.
B.Light objects fall faster than heavy ones.
C.Heavy objects fall faster than light ones.
D.All objects fall at the same rate regardless of mass.

Answer:

D.All objects fall at the same rate regardless of mass.

Explanation:

The balls all have the same shape, but different masses. The data in the table show that they pass each marker at the same time. Therefore, they are falling at the same rate or velocity, regardless of mass.
